Best Thomas County Public Middle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 3 public middle schools serving 390 students in Thomas County, KS.
The top-ranked public middle schools in Thomas County, KS are Golden Plains Middle School, Colby Middle School and Brewster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Thomas County, KS public middle schools have an average math proficiency score of 21% (versus the Kansas public middle school average of 26%), and reading proficiency score of 22% (versus the 28% statewide average). Middle schools in Thomas County have an average ranking of 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Kansas public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 20%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Kansas public middle school average of 35% (majority Hispanic).
